Transaction 2dd1c77b03d465995701d41b139e778da6fafd26a141560199df36b005614ea2
1 Input
1 Output
-
2dd1c77b03d465995701d41b139e778da6fafd26a141560199df36b005614ea2:0
- value
- 166261639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ecaf6120521c58b76c895a3e46242076906dce0c OP_EQUAL
- address
- MVUdoGzHcCAj95zGHPaLoVtwURfmie1U67